"Everything is about sex. Except sex. Sex is about power" (read body of post)

FYI: The quote is not really from House of Cards. It's often attributed to Oscar Wilde (which is who I thought originally said it), but it turns out that's apocryphal and there's no basis to it. The quote appeared in an interview with author Michael Cunningham in 1995, who only said he "thought" it was Oscar Wilde. So it may predate that, but actual authorship is unknown. Source: https://quoteinvestigator.com/2018/06/05/sex-power/
